So this is strange. It seems I no longer need my lovely Yamaha mixer. The ADA8000 works a treat, so far at least, and I can monitor with the Mac turned off by simply saving the monitoring config to the hardware. There have been some issues with it not always setting the sync source back to ADAT after a power cycle but it's really fast to solve and not a showstopper. Blimey, something worked! Multi-tracking in Logic kicking along real nicely on my first tests at least, after I turned off software monitoring to prevent the weird chorusing.

Oddly, the Pro24 calls its digital inputs 5&6 which rather disrupts my naming of ports. Logic is supposed to let you rename the inputs but oddly they don't show up in the program after that, or at least they didn't earlier.

May be worth moving some submixers to make best use of them and the available I/O.
